MPs AVERT CLASH IN LOK SABHA



NEW DELHI, April 22 (UNI, PTI)—The Lok Sabha today witnessed an unprecedented scene of two senior members almost coming to blows amid an agitated discussion on a call-attention motion on the court order for the arrest of Defence Security Corps personnel, responsible for the Cossipore Gun Factory firing. Mr. Tirath Chaudhuri (RSP) and Mr. N.P.C. Naidu (Cong) were seen advancing towards each other after exchanging angry words. Fearing a clash, several members, including Mr. A.S. Saigal, Mr. G.G. Swell and Mr. S.M. Banerjee prevailed upon Mr. Chaudhuri to calm down. A few feet away from Mr. Chaudhuri’s seat, Mr. Naidu was prevented from clashing with Mr. Chaudhuri by the Minister of State for Steel and Heavy Engineering, Mr. K.C. Pant. The discussion was marked by a reprimand of Mr. Jyotirmoy Basu (CPI-M) by Speaker Sanjiya Reddy for derogatory references against the Chair. “It is regrettable and this should not be repeated in future,” Mr. Reddy said.
